gdb.base/interrupt.exp: Use send_inferior/$inferior_spawn_id
The gdb.base/interrupt.exp test is important for testing system call restarting, but because it depends on inferior I/O, it ends up skipped against gdbserver. This patch adjusts the test to use send_inferior and $inferior_spawn_id so it works against GDBserver. gdb/testsuite/ChangeLog: 2015-04-07 Pedro Alves <palves@redhat.com> * gdb.base/interrupt.exp: Don't skip if $inferior_spawn_id != $gdb_spawn_id. Use send_inferior and $inferior_spawn_id to interact with inferior program.
